Chord is a structured peer-to-peer (P2P) overlay network in which participating peers share resources as equals. To find a specific data item within the network, Chord system provide a lookup mechanism that matches a given key to a network node responsible for the value associated with that key. This paper describes a fast and efficient template-based chord recognition method. We introduce three chord models taking into account one or more harmonics for the notes of the chord. The use of pre-determined chord models enables to consider several types of chords (major, minor, dominant seventh, minor seventh, augmented, diminished...). Using short and long contexts, the present study investigated musical priming effects that are based on chord repetition and harmonic relatedness. A musical target (a chord) was preceded by either an identical prime or a different but harmonically related prime.
